Overview of Okami HD and Its Trophy System

Okami HD offers a captivating trophy system with 51 achievements‚ including 42 bronze‚ 5 silver‚ 3 gold‚ and 1 platinum trophy․ The journey begins with the “Yomigami” trophy for learning Rejuvenation and culminates in the challenging “No More Fish in the Sea” trophy for completing the Fish Tome․ While most trophies are straightforward‚ some require precision and dedication․ Missable trophies‚ like the first Stray Bead in the River of the Heavens‚ add complexity‚ making strategic planning essential․ This guide helps players navigate the system‚ ensuring no achievement is overlooked‚ whether you’re a casual player or a dedicated trophy hunter․

Missable Trophies

Okami HD has specific missable trophies‚ such as the first Stray Bead in the River of the Heavens and certain story-related achievements․ Be cautious of the point of no return‚ as some trophies cannot be obtained after progressing past key areas like the Ark of Yamato․ Ensure you complete all required tasks before advancing to avoid missing out on these achievements permanently․

Identifying and Avoiding Missable Trophies in Okami HD

Missable trophies in Okami HD require careful attention‚ as some cannot be unlocked after specific points in the game․ The first Stray Bead in the River of the Heavens is easy to overlook‚ while certain story-related achievements‚ like “No Furball on the Menu‚” must be completed before finishing the Sunken Ship mini-dungeon․ Key areas‚ such as the Ark of Yamato‚ act as points of no return‚ making it crucial to finish all tasks beforehand․ Use a checklist to track progress and avoid missing these trophies permanently․ Proactively seeking out missable content ensures a smooth path to the Platinum Trophy․

Bestiary Completion

Completing the Bestiary requires defeating and recording all 164 enemies in Okami HD․ Each entry provides insights into their weaknesses and strategies․ Some enemies are rare or appear under specific conditions‚ making thorough exploration and combat engagement essential․ This challenging task is crucial for trophy completion and enhances your understanding of the game’s diverse adversary roster․ Ensure no foe goes unrecorded to achieve this impressive milestone․

Defeating and Recording All Enemies for the Bestiary Trophy

To unlock the Bestiary Trophy‚ you must defeat and record all 164 enemies in Okami HD․ This includes regular foes‚ bosses‚ and rare creatures․ Use abilities like Rejuvenation to revive defeated enemies and ensure they are recorded․ Some enemies only appear in specific areas or under certain conditions‚ requiring thorough exploration․ Defeating enemies with Golden Fury or other divine instruments also helps․ Missable enemies‚ such as those in timed events‚ must be prioritized․ Keep track of your progress and revisit areas to complete any missing entries․ This challenging task rewards dedication and ensures no foe goes unrecorded․
